Further deliberating the relationship between do-not-resuscitate and the increased risk of death

Sci Rep. 2016 Mar 18:6:23182. doi: 10.1038/srep23182.

Abstract

Few studies have examined the outcome of do-not-resuscitate (DNR) patients in surgical intensive care units (SICUs). This study deliberated the association between a DNR decision and the increased risk of death methodologically and ethically. This study was conducted in three SICUs. We collected patients' demographic characteristics, clinical characteristics, and the status of death/survival at SICU and hospital discharge. We used Kaplan-Meier survival curves to compare the time from SICU admission to the end of SICU stay for the DNR and non-DNR patients. Differences in the Kaplan-Meier curves were tested using log-rank tests. We also conducted a Cox proportional hazards model to account for the effect of a DNR decision on mortality. We found that having a DNR order was associated with an increased risk of death during the SICU stay (aRR = 2.39, p < 0.01) after adjusting for severity of illness upon SICU admission and other confounding variables. To make the conclusion that a DNR order is causally related to an increased risk of death, or that a DNR order increases the risk of death is absolutely questionable. By clarifying this key point, we expect that the discussion of DNR between healthcare professionals and patients/surrogate decision-makers will not be hampered or delayed.
